High Pitch Noise Fixed!!!!!
 
Thanks to the help of bumblez and his dealer in richmond I'm finally getting rid of the dreaded high pitch ECU noise that has driven me crazy the past couple of months. The first time i brought the car in nobody could hear the sound but me and the dealership acted like i was just hearing things. I told them that I was 100% positive the sound was there as I am an air traffic controller and have my hearing tested annually. After that unsuccessfull attempt I PM'd bumblez which led to me calling his dealership and speaking with the gentlemen that solved the issue for him. They were AWESOME!! and explained to me how Nissan knows about the issue yet won't issue a TSB because so few people are actually capable of hearing the sound. They gave me the part number and told me to tell my dealership that Nissan is aware of the problem and on the Nissan Tech Line they acknowledge the issue and list the fix. It has something to do with the capasitors and ECU that causes this head splitting noise to occur. Even with all this info that i brought to the table on my second venture to the dealership they stated that the problem need to be reciprocated and they needed to hear it. This is where the Richmond dealership gave me the best tip. They told me to have a young female, if available, that works at the my dealership to sit in the car because it seems they hear the sound instantly and better then most males. After about 2 or 3 guys said they couldn't hear the sound I had them bring a young lady that worked in the service dept. to sit in my car. Immediatley she confirmed the noise and it was only then that my dealership searched their Tech Line and found all the information that I had already given them.
